Kursdetails

โ€ข Maritime Navigation Fundamentals – Understanding the basics of maritime navigation, including the use of charts, navigational aids, and communication systems.
โ€ข Inter-Ship Communication Techniques – Exploring various communication methods used in marine traffic coordination, including VHF radio, Automatic Identification System (AIS), and Inmarsat communication systems.
โ€ข Marine Traffic Regulations – Examining international and national regulations governing marine traffic, including the International Regulations for Preventing Collisions at Sea (COLREGs) and local traffic separation schemes.
โ€ข Maritime Safety Procedures – Learning about safety procedures, emergency response plans, and contingency measures to ensure safe inter-ship traffic coordination.
โ€ข Ship Handling and Maneuvering – Understanding the principles of ship handling, maneuvering, and bridge resource management to ensure efficient and safe vessel movements.
โ€ข Marine Weather and Oceanography – Examining the impact of marine weather and oceanographic conditions on inter-ship traffic coordination, including fog, storms, and tidal streams.
โ€ข Maritime Information Systems – Familiarizing with various maritime information systems, such as the Automatic Identification System (AIS), Long Range Identification and Tracking (LRIT), and the Global Maritime Distress and Safety System (GMDSS).
โ€ข Marine Pollution Prevention – Exploring the role of inter-ship traffic coordinators in preventing marine pollution, including oil spills and waste disposal.
